[Moin-devel] CVS: MoinMoin config.py,1.61,1.62 wikiutil.py,1.83,1.84

J?rgen Hermann jhermann at users.sourceforge.net
Sat Mar 9 07:56:15 EST 2002


Update of /cvsroot/moin/MoinMoin
In directory usw-pr-cvs1:/tmp/cvs-serv12641/MoinMoin

Modified Files:
	config.py wikiutil.py 
Log Message:
navi_bar as list of pages


Index: config.py
===================================================================
RCS file: /cvsroot/moin/MoinMoin/config.py,v
retrieving revision 1.61
retrieving revision 1.62
diff -C2 -r1.61 -r1.62
*** config.py	7 Mar 2002 20:19:35 -0000	1.61
--- config.py	9 Mar 2002 15:55:22 -0000	1.62
***************
*** 74,126 ****
      'mail_from': None,
      'max_macro_size': 50,
!     'navi_bar': '''
! <table cellpadding=0 cellspacing=3 border=0 style="background-color:#C8C8C8;text-decoration:none">
!   <tr>
! 
!     <td valign=top align=center bgcolor="#E8E8E8">
!       <font face="Arial,Helvetica" size="-1">
!          <b>%(sitename)s</b> 
!       </font>
!     </td>
!     
!     <td valign=top align=center bgcolor="#E8E8E8">
!       <font face="Arial,Helvetica" size="-1">
!          <a style="text-decoration:none" href="%(scriptname)s/%(page_front_page)s">%(page_front_page)s</a> 
!       </font>
!     </td>
!     
!     <td valign=top align=center bgcolor="#E8E8E8">
!       <font face="Arial,Helvetica" size="-1">
!          <a style="text-decoration:none" href="%(scriptname)s/%(page_recent_changes)s">%(page_recent_changes)s</a> 
!       </font>
!     </td>
! 
!     <td valign=top align=center bgcolor="#E8E8E8">
!       <font face="Arial,Helvetica" size="-1">
!          <a style="text-decoration:none" href="%(scriptname)s/%(page_title_index)s">%(page_title_index)s</a> 
!       </font>
!     </td>
! 
!     <td valign=top align=center bgcolor="#E8E8E8">
!       <font face="Arial,Helvetica" size="-1">
!          <a style="text-decoration:none" href="%(scriptname)s/%(page_word_index)s">%(page_word_index)s</a> 
!       </font>
!     </td>
!     
!     <td valign=top align=center bgcolor="#E8E8E8">
!       <font face="Arial,Helvetica" size="-1">
!          <a style="text-decoration:none" href="%(scriptname)s/%(page_site_navigation)s">%(page_site_navigation)s</a> 
!       </font>
!     </td>
!     
!     <td valign=top align=center bgcolor="#E8E8E8">
!       <font face="Arial,Helvetica" size="-1">
!          <a style="text-decoration:none" href="%(scriptname)s/%(page_help_contents)s">%(page_help_contents)s</a> 
!       </font>
!     </td>
! 
!   </tr>
! </table>
! ''',
      'nonexist_qm': 0,
  
--- 74,85 ----
      'mail_from': None,
      'max_macro_size': 50,
!     'navi_bar': [
!         'FrontPage',
!         'RecentChanges',
!         'TitleIndex',
!         'WordIndex',
!         'SiteNavigation',
!         'HelpContents',
!     ],
      'nonexist_qm': 0,
  

Index: wikiutil.py
===================================================================
RCS file: /cvsroot/moin/MoinMoin/wikiutil.py,v
retrieving revision 1.83
retrieving revision 1.84
diff -C2 -r1.83 -r1.84
*** wikiutil.py	6 Mar 2002 22:36:52 -0000	1.83
--- wikiutil.py	9 Mar 2002 15:55:22 -0000	1.84
***************
*** 404,414 ****
      from MoinMoin.Page import Page
  
!     # get name of help page
      page_help_contents = getSysPage('HelpContents').page_name
      page_title_index = getSysPage('TitleIndex').page_name
      page_word_index = getSysPage('WordIndex').page_name
-     page_site_navigation = getSysPage('SiteNavigation').page_name
      page_user_prefs = getSysPage('UserPreferences').page_name
-     page_recent_changes = getSysPage('RecentChanges').page_name
      page_edit_tips = getSysPage('HelpOnFormatting').page_name
  
--- 404,412 ----
      from MoinMoin.Page import Page
  
!     # get name of system pages
      page_help_contents = getSysPage('HelpContents').page_name
      page_title_index = getSysPage('TitleIndex').page_name
      page_word_index = getSysPage('WordIndex').page_name
      page_user_prefs = getSysPage('UserPreferences').page_name
      page_edit_tips = getSysPage('HelpOnFormatting').page_name
  
***************
*** 508,521 ****
      # print the navigation bar (if configured)
      if config.navi_bar:
!         print config.navi_bar % {
              'scriptname': webapi.getScriptname(),
!             'sitename': config.sitename,
!             'page_front_page': config.page_front_page,
!             'page_site_navigation': page_site_navigation,
!             'page_recent_changes': page_recent_changes,
!             'page_title_index': page_title_index,
!             'page_word_index': page_word_index,
!             'page_help_contents': page_help_contents,
          }
  
      # print a message if one is given
--- 506,528 ----
      # print the navigation bar (if configured)
      if config.navi_bar:
!         print (
!             '<table cellpadding=0 cellspacing=3 border=0 style="background-color:#C8C8C8;text-decoration:none">'
!             '<tr><td valign=top align=center bgcolor="#E8E8E8">'
!             '<font face="Arial,Helvetica" size="-1"> <b>%(sitename)s</b> '
!             '</font></td>') % {'sitename': config.sitename,}
! 
!         for pagename in config.navi_bar:
!             pagename = getSysPage(pagename).page_name
!             print (
!                 '<td valign=top align=center bgcolor="#E8E8E8">'
!                 '<font face="Arial,Helvetica" size="-1">'
!                 ' <a style="text-decoration:none" href="%(scriptname)s/%(pagelink)s">%(pagename)s</a> '
!                 '</font></td>') % {
              'scriptname': webapi.getScriptname(),
!             'pagelink': quoteWikiname(pagename),
!             'pagename': pagename,
          }
+ 
+         print '</tr></table>'
  
      # print a message if one is given





More information about the Moin-devel mailing list